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6387061 57368 406137
506087 3527384605
506087 3527384605
74581 58 39607 061331289
All about undefined
Interested in learning more?
506087 3527384605
74581 58 39607 061331289
See more
89 7597778 4418649
426862439 033614 0943 6154299 344
See more
93 8810
0337622 677925249 80
See more